AMI is the governance token of Amnis, a DAO on the Aptos blockchain. Amnis issues amAPT and stAPT, liquid staking tokens representing staked APT in its stake pool.

Users can create any financial market on Injective's fast, cross-chain, zero gas fee, secure, and fully decentralized exchange protocol. The trading infrastructure of Injective is supported entirely by a central limit order book that integrates the user-friendly interface and speed of centralized exchanges with the transparency of decentralized exchanges. Native token INJ is a scarce asset that used for governance, exchange value capture, liquidity mining, and staking.
